Ma'at: Meaning & Origin

Ma'at is a girl's name of Egyptian Mythology origin meaning “Goddess of truth, justice, and cosmic order; embodies balance..” With 1 syllable, it is short and easy to say. Common nicknames include Maa. Ma'at is an uncommon, distinctive choice for girls, with a popularity score of 10 out of 100 — perfect for parents seeking something rare.
